Connor went through this same thing for 3 months! And finally he got better after trying several antibiotics. So hang in there. It does get better. Those coughs can be really stubborn.

Another thing we did was buy a soft cat bed (totally enclosed with a hole for an entry) to keep any breeze from a fan off him at night. That's when he really started getting better and he loved the bed. We put it between our pillows so I could keep an eye on him. (Get one that will go in the washer and dryer so you can keep it clean.) I got Connor's at Walmart.
